首页 > 生活百科 >

MySQL(管理)

2025-05-13 21:59:43

问题描述:

MySQL(管理),有没有人理理我呀?急死啦!

最佳答案

推荐答案

2025-05-13 21:59:43

在当今信息化的时代,数据库作为信息存储和管理的核心系统,在企业运营中扮演着至关重要的角色。而MySQL,作为全球最受欢迎的开源关系型数据库管理系统之一,其高效、稳定的特点使其成为众多企业的首选。然而,如何有效地管理和优化MySQL,确保系统的性能与安全性,是每个DBA(数据库管理员)必须面对的重要课题。

首先,备份与恢复是MySQL管理的基础。定期进行数据备份可以防止因硬件故障、软件错误或人为误操作导致的数据丢失。MySQL提供了多种备份方式,包括逻辑备份(如使用mysqldump命令)和物理备份(如复制数据文件)。同时,为了提高灾难恢复效率,建议制定详细的备份计划,并测试恢复过程以确保备份的有效性。

其次,性能调优是提升MySQL运行效率的关键环节。这包括调整服务器配置参数、优化查询语句以及合理设计数据库结构等多方面的工作。例如,通过分析慢查询日志找出执行时间较长的SQL语句,并对其进行重构;利用索引加速数据检索;根据实际需求选择合适的数据类型等。此外,还应注意监控服务器资源使用情况,及时调整缓存大小或增加硬件资源以满足业务增长的需求。

再者,安全防护也不容忽视。随着网络攻击手段日益复杂化,保护数据库免受非法访问变得尤为重要。可以通过设置强密码策略、限制远程访问权限、启用SSL加密连接等方式增强安全性。另外,定期更新补丁程序及修复已知漏洞也是防范外部威胁的有效措施之一。

最后但同样重要的是,持续学习与交流能够帮助我们更好地应对不断变化的技术挑战。关注官方文档和技术社区中的最新动态,与其他专业人士分享经验教训,不仅有助于拓宽视野,还能激发创新思维,从而为解决实际问题提供更多可能性。

总之,“MySQL管理”并非一蹴而就的事情,而是需要长期投入精力去实践和完善的过程。只有将上述各方面工作有机结合在一起,才能构建起一个既健壮又灵活可靠的MySQL环境,为企业创造更大的价值。

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。